| Obverse description | A centrally positioned King Protea flower in full bloom occupies the field, rendered in fine relief with detailed petals and foliage extending to the lower portion of the coin. The legend SOUTH AFRICA arcs along the upper periphery in raised Latin lettering, while the date 2011 appears in the lower exergue flanked by small decorative stars. The design is attributed to George Kruger Gray and is executed within a beaded inner border. The overall composition is elegant and botanically precise, characteristic of South African commemorative coinage of this series. |
